Belmont University Frist College of Medicine acceptance rate
PreMD does not publish an acceptance rate for individual schools. The free national sources publish applications and matriculants, not the number of offers a school made, so an acceptance rate cannot be calculated from them without inventing the missing number.
What can be published from those figures is the ratio: Belmont University Frist College of Medicine received 2,831 applications for 54 seats in the entering class, or about 52.4 applications per seat.
Who Belmont University Frist College of Medicine accepts applications from
| Applicant group | Policy |
|---|---|
| Out-of-state Applicants | FCoM is a private medical school with no preference for Tennessee residents. |
| Canadian Applicants | Canadian applicants have the same admissions process as all other applicants. |
| International Applicants | International applicants have the same admissions process as all other applicants. |
| DACA Status Applicants | DACA Status applicants have the same admissions process as all other applicants. |

Who receives a secondary: Selected applicants are invited to fill out the supplemental application, typically, we look for a 3.0 GPA and 500 MCAT score for supplemental application invitation.
Prerequisite coursework
| Subject | Required or recommended | Credits |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| Biochemistry | Required | 3 | — |
| Biology | Required | 8 | — |
| Cell Biology | Recommended | Not stated | — |
| Chemistry | Required | 16 | Should include 8 hours of General Chemistry and 8 hours of Organic Chemistry |
| Composition & Rhetoric | Required | 6 | Any type of English or Writing Intense course will suffice. |
| Genetics | Recommended | Not stated | — |
| Mathematics | Required | 3 | — |
| Microbiology | Recommended | Not stated | — |
| Molecular Biology | Recommended | Not stated | — |
| Physics | Required | 8 | — |
Belmont University Frist College of Medicine interview
Two interviews are included – a traditional open file interview and a structured closed file interview. Each interview lasts 30 minutes. The rest of the interview session is designed for applicants to learn about FCoM and ask questions.
PreMD reads that as a one-on-one interview, closed file, and sets up its interview practice for this school accordingly.
We anticipate our first interview invitations being sent in August.
Candidates will be sent information to review and familiarize themselves with prior to the interview day. During the interview session, there will be plenty of time to ask questions and learn more about the topics important to you in selecting a medical school. Two interviews are conducted. One is a traditional open-file interview with a faculty member or member of the admissions committee lasting approximately 30 minutes. The second is a structured interview conducted by a member of the FCoM community that includes standard questions and the interviewer is blind to all application materials. This interview may feel similar to an MMI experience. As a newer school, the interview day is designed specifically to allow time for applicants to ask questions and learn more about areas of interest.
- Regional interviews
- Regional interviews are not available. All interviews will be conducted virtually via Zoom. Accepted students will be invited to campus to visit.
- Video interview
- FCoM will conduct virtual interviews for the 2027 admissions cycle. Applicants can expect information and instructions via email.
Belmont University Frist College of Medicine waitlist
- Typical positions offered
- The waitlist at FCoM is live and regularly reviewed. Those added to the waitlist could be invited to join the class at any time in the cycle.
The waitlist is live, unranked, and reviewed at each Admissions Committee meeting throughout the cycle. Candidates on the waitlist may be offered admission at any point in the cycle.
Belmont University Frist College of Medicine mission
Our Mission: The Thomas F. Frist, Jr. College of Medicine at Belmont University is dedicated to cultivating diverse physician leaders of character who embrace a whole- person approach to healing in a community of service-learning, inspired by character and the love and grace of Christ. Our Vision: Shaping medicine through transformative whole person care.
